About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Identify, develop, and secure new business opportunities within the data center, mission-critical, industrial cooling, and power generation markets.
- Lead commercial negotiations and contract discussions to secure profitable business opportunities.
- Manage the complete sales cycle from opportunity identification through project award and implementation within the perspective territory.
- Primary point of contact for assigned customers and strategic accounts.
- Develop customer-specific growth plans and identify opportunities for account expansion.
- Present technical and commercial solutions to customers, consultants, and executive stakeholders while providing market intelligence, competitive insights, and customer feedback to support business growth and strategic decision-making.
- Collaborate with engineering, application engineering, proposal, and operations teams to develop customer solutions. Need a good understanding and solid understanding of systems solutions for cooling in the DC and power markets.
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business, Marketing, or related discipline preferred.
- 5–7 years of successful sales or business development experience within the Data Center, Power Generation, mission-critical infrastructure, HVAC, thermal management, or industrial equipment industries.
- Proven experience developing new business and securing large project opportunities.
- Experience negotiating commercial agreements and managing complex sales cycles.
- Strong understanding of thermodynamics, heat transfer, cooling technologies, or related engineering principles.
- Experience working with data centers, mission-critical infrastructure, power generation, or industrial cooling applications.
- Established network within the hyperscale, colocation, engineering consulting, mission-critical, or power generation markets, with a strong understanding of the industry's decision-making process, key business drivers, and the ability to negotiate complex commercial opportunities.
- Existing network within the hyperscale, colocation, engineering consulting, or mission-critical industries.
- Experience managing multi-million-dollar projects and strategic accounts.
- Familiarity with data center cooling technologies and emerging market trends.
